准分子激光轰击Y-Ba-Cu-O高温超导靶的空间分辨光谱研究

摘    要:采用WP4-光学多道分析仪对准分子激光轰击Y_1Ba_2Cu_3O_x超导靶产生的等离子体辐射进行了空间分辨测量和研究。实验结果表明,在靶面的邻近区(d<0.4mm),等离子体辐射为较强的连续谱,并迭加有Y、Ba原子和Y~+、Ba~+离子基态电子跃迁的自吸收线。Y、Ba、Cu原子和相应的一价离子以及金属氧化物分子激发态的发射谱线仅在距靶面为0.4mm以外的区域出现。光谱的测量结果支持靶面表层发生爆炸、出射分子簇团和固体微粒的激光烧蚀沉积动力学机制解释。

Space-resolved spectroscopy studies of excimer laser ablation of Y-Ba-Cu-O superconducting target

Abstract:Space-resolved luminescence spectra of excimer laser ablation of high Tc Y-Ba -Cu-O superconducting target was studied with WP4-optioal multichannel analyzer. In the vicinity region of the target surface (d<0.35mm), a wide continuum spectrum with salf-absorption lines due to the electronic transition from the ground states of Y, Ba and Y+, Ba+ was observed. The excited state emission spectrum lines of atoms, ions and moleoulae were detected only at the distance larger than 0.35mm. These experiment results support the dynamic explanation of explosion and ejecting molecular cluster or solid fragments on laser ablation.
